@STG There's a beach in Wellington, New Zealand called oriental bay. All of the sand there is artificial so I scooped some up into a container and use it to base my minis I also throw some little rocks from the old citadel basing kit in there for variety. Those are the ones that are grey instead of brown. The brown paint process is Rhinox hide, then an overbrush of bestial brown, and a finer overbrush of rakarth flesh. The stone is done using mechanicus standard grey base, overbrush codex grey, and a finer overbrush of adminustratum grey. I then wash the whole base with agrax earthshade to bring the two colours together, and finally apply flock.

Hey folks - trucked away at a lot of the Watch Master today - a really tough miniature to paint i've found so far, but patience helps to work its way around all difficult bits in the miniature. I've sort of had to paint him from the inside out, doing all of the deepest parts first because mistakes were inevitable with this guy, but most of those tedious parts are out of the way, and now its just the fun stuff, so i'm really looking forward to finishing him off he's going to be an Imperial Fist, by name of Axios Jett, but i'm DREADING freehanding an IF logo in that tiny circle on the eagle pad, but it will be a learning experience either way.

Anyway, I took a few shots throughout the day, the last two are where he's at currently. The gold is very early stages, so it will be made less flat and will fit the aesthetic much more when it's complete. I'm pleased with how the cloak is looking - it's the only finished part so far
